Episode 9 of Scam 1992: The Harshad Mehta Story , titled "Ek Crore Ka Suitcase", serves as the series' most politically explosive chapter. In this episode, the narrative shifts from a financial crime drama to a high-stakes political thriller as Harshad Mehta, pushed to the brink by the CBI and the government, makes a desperate attempt to bring down those at the top. The Central Conflict: The Prime Minister Allegation

The crux of the episode is Harshad’s sensational claim that he paid a bribe of ₹1 crore to the then-Prime Minister, P.V. Narasimha Rao. This accusation is presented through a dramatic press conference where Harshad, alongside his lawyer Ram Jethmalani, attempts to prove that a suitcase containing the cash could indeed be carried by one person—a direct rebuttal to the government’s defense.

Political Leverage: Facing relentless raids and interrogation, Harshad uses this claim as a shield, hoping to force the government into a settlement.

The CBI's Tactics: The CBI, led by Madhavan, intensifies its pressure on Harshad’s associates, including Bhushan Bhatt, who is subjected to harsh interrogation to break Harshad's inner circle. Cinematic and Narrative Techniques

The episode is lauded for its blend of fiction and reality, notably using original archival footage from the real-life press conference. This technique anchors the show's drama in historical fact, reinforcing the gravity of the scandal that shook India's political foundations in the early 90s. Key Themes

Systemic Corruption: The episode exposes that the "scam" was not just a broker's greed but involved deep-rooted corruption within political and banking institutions.

The Power of Narrative: It highlights how Harshad attempted to use the media to pivot from a "villain" to a victim of a larger political game.

Individual vs. System: The tension between Harshad’s individual ambition and the crushing weight of the state machinery reaches its zenith here.

By the end of the episode, Harshad's bold gamble fails to provide the immunity he sought, setting the stage for his final downfall in the series finale. Scam 1992 Season 01 Episode 09 Recap: Ek Crore Ka Suitcase
